PETALING JAYA:
The secretary of an academic staff association at a public varsity in Melaka has been arrested for allegedly misappropriating RM84,500 of the association’s funds to foot his wife’s costs for a court case.

A source said the man, 47, allegedly misused his position in the association to obtain the funds in order to pay for a court order against his wife, as well as her legal fees.

The suspect was arrested at around 5.10pm yesterday after giving his statement at the Malaysian Anti-Corruption Commission’s (MACC) headquarters in Melaka, Berita Harian reported.

The Ayer Keroh magistrates’ court allowed MACC to place the suspect under remand until Sept 7.

Melaka MACC chief Adi Supian Shafie confirmed the arrest.
